Located on Jln Datuk Kaya Wan Mohammad Benteng, Bunguran Timur District, Sunday (18/8) morning, the Regional Secretary of Natuna Regency, Boy Wijanarko Varianto officially released the 79th Anniversary of the Republic of Indonesia Cultural Parade in 2024.
The route taken by approximately four thousand parade participants began from the New Market intersection (Jl. Datuk Kaya Wan Mohammad Benteng, to the finish at the Globe intersection on Jalan Soekarno Hatta, Piwang Beach.
At the finish location, the Regent of Natuna, Wan SIswandi, Vice Regent of Natuna, members of the DPRD, members of Forkopimda, OPD leaders and community leaders were present and crowded with visitors who wanted to watch the parade.
Wan Siswandi stated that the purpose of holding this Cultural Parade was none other than to provide the widest possible space for the community to display their respective cultural arts, considering that among the participants were representatives of community harmony organizations from various regions (Paguyuban) both from inside and outside Natuna.
With the existing diversity, Wan Siswandi hopes to continue to build friendship, brotherhood in ethnic diversity, customs and culture, becoming the main potential in driving regional development.
Gratitude was also expressed to the elements of the three (TNI) and the Police and all supporting elements, so that this activity could run smoothly, orderly and safely.
On the same occasion, the Head of the Natuna Regency National Unity and Political Agency (Bakesbangpol), Helmi Wahyuda, explained that this activity was the realization of the regional head’s instructions that had been running from one year earlier.
Seeing the high enthusiasm of the Natuna community, his party plans to organize a National Culture Performance as a continuation of this Cultural Parade, as a form of appreciation from the Natuna Regency Government for the harmony that continues to be maintained in the midst of existing diversity.
As for some elements of activity participants involved in the composition of the parade this time, including representatives from various associations, schools, government elements and organizations. (Pro_kopim/D&S)
